Ingredients You’ll Need
Gathering simple, tasty ingredients is the key to making these Cheesy Stuffed Meatloaf Bites shine. Each component plays an essential role, from building the perfect meat mixture to adding that saucy glaze and fresh brightness at the end.
- 1 pound ground beef: The star of the dish providing juicy flavor and hearty texture.
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s: Helps bind the meatloaf bites and keeps them tender.
- 1/4 cup milk: Adds moisture to the mixture, ensuring every bite is juicy.
- 1 large egg: Acts as a binder for the ingredients, keeping everything together.
- 1 small onion, finely chopped: Infuses mild sweetness and a bit of crunch.
- 2 cloves garlic, minced: Packs in deep savory notes that boost flavor.
- 1 teaspoon salt: Enhances all the flavors in the meat mixture.
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per: Adds a subtle kick of spice for balance.
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ce: Introduces umami richness and depth.
- 1/2 cup ketchup: A tangy base for the glaze that caramelizes beautifully.
- 1 tablespoon mustard: Gives the glaze a sharp contrast to the sweet ketchup.
- 1/2 cup grated cheddar cheese: The melty surprise inside every meatloaf bite.
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ped: Brightens the bites with a fresh herbal finish and works as a garnish.
How to Make Cheesy Stuffed Meatloaf Bites Recipe
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
Set your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per. This simple prep step will ensure your meatloaf bites bake evenly without sticking, making clean-up a breeze.
Step 2: Mix the Meatloaf Base
Grab a large bowl and combine the ground beef, breadcrumbs, milk, egg, onion, minced garlic, salt, pepper, and Worcestershire sauce. Use your hands or a spoon to mix everything until it’s uniformly combined—this is your flavorful foundation.
Step 3: Form and Stuff the Bites
Take a portion of your meat mixture and flatten it slightly on your hand or a work surface. Place a spoonful of grated cheddar cheese in the center, then carefully wrap the meat around it, shaping into a ball. Repeat with the rest of the mixture until you have juicy, cheese-filled meatloaf bites ready to cook.
Step 4: Prepare the Tasty Glaze
In a small bowl, whisk together the ketchup and mustard. This tangy glaze is going to give your Cheesy Stuffed Meatloaf Bites Recipe that signature caramelized top, bursting with flavor each time you take a bite.
Step 5: Bake to Perfection
Place your meatloaf bites onto the lined baking sheet and brush the ketchup-mustard mixture generously over each bite. Pop them in the oven and bake for 25 to 30 minutes. When done, the meatloaf bites should be cooked through with a beautifully caramelized, slightly crispy glaze on top.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Once cooled, place any leftover meatloaf bites in an airtight container and store them in the fridge. They’ll stay fresh and delicious for up to 3 days, making for fantastic next-day snacks or quick meals.
Freezing
These meatloaf bites freeze wonderfully. Lay them on a baking sheet to freeze individually before transferring to a freezer-safe bag or container. Properly frozen, they can last up to 3 months without losing any flavor or texture.
Reheating
Reheat leftovers in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es or until warmed through. The oven helps maintain their crisp glaze and warms the cheese inside perfectly. Microwaving works too, but may soften the exterior slightly.
FAQs
Can I use ground turkey instead of beef for this recipe?
Absolutely! Ground turkey is a leaner option and will work well for the Cheesy Stuffed Meatloaf Bites Recipe. Just be sure to keep an eye on moisture since turkey can dry out faster; consider adding a bit more milk or a splash of olive oil.
What kind of cheese works best inside the meatloaf bites?
Sharp cheddar is a classic choice for a reason—it melts well and has a wonderful tangy flavor. However, you can experiment with mozzarella for extra gooey stretch or pepper jack if you want a little spicy kick.
Can I make these bites gluten-free?
Yes! Simply swap the regular breadcrumbs for gluten-free ones, or substitute with crushed gluten-free crackers or oats. This adjustment keeps your Cheesy Stuffed Meatloaf Bites Recipe safe for gluten-sensitive eaters without sacrificing texture.
Is the ketchup and mustard glaze necessary?
While optional, the glaze adds a fantastic tangy-sweet contrast that beautifully caramelizes as it bakes. You can skip it if you prefer a more straightforward meatloaf bite, or switch it up with barbecue sauce for a smoky twist.
How can I tell when the meatloaf bites are fully cooked?
The safest way is to check the internal temperature with a meat thermometer—it should read 160°F (71°C). They should also be firm to the touch and have a nicely browned glaze on top.
